Transaction 240b89623a15f24baaa3f1c6603b2ee09a267bcb7e744211961beb0c5bddeb2c
1 Input
1 Output
-
240b89623a15f24baaa3f1c6603b2ee09a267bcb7e744211961beb0c5bddeb2c:0
- value
- 23654880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23afb31b21aaba80738702abb3aa845efe74531e O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Fh8YEjYr6rfdMz2igpZHgV1VgNdo8RQp